In the field of dentistry, nanotechnology, or nanodentistry, is making significant strides in maintaining oral health through the use of nanomaterials. Within orthodontics, nanotechnology leads to advanced research and development, specifically in the areas of nanoindentation and atomic force microscopy (AFM) for evaluating the nanoscale surface characteristics and mechanical properties of orthodontic products, such as brackets and archwires. A nano indenter, coupled with an atomic force microscope, assesses the nanoscale surface roughness, surface free energy, yield strength, scratch hardness, elastic modulus, fracture toughness, and wear properties of these orthodontic components. The application of nanotechnology in orthodontics is still in its nascent stage, offering vast opportunities for research and innovation in this domain.
